ALPAGU is a national strike un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) system designed to be portable by a single operator, featuring fixed wings, electric propulsion, and high-precision target destruction capabilities. Developed by STM Defense Technologies Engineering and Trade Inc., ALPAGU is primarily used for tactical-level reconnaissance, surveillance, and high-precision elimination of targets outside the line of sight.

ALPAGU is a lightweight and ergonomic system featuring a composite airframe and indigenous avionics. The system consists of a fixed-wing strike UAV, a pneumatic launcher (launch tube), and a mobile ground control station. The platform can be effectively deployed without detection by enemy forces due to its low radar signature, high speed, and quiet operation. Launched via a pneumatic canister, ALPAGU is portable by a single soldier and can be rapidly prepared for mission deployment.
Thanks to STM’s indigenous embedded mission computer and flight control algorithms, ALPAGU possesses full autonomous navigation capability. During missions, target detection and destruction are conducted under the “Man-in-the-Loop” principle, with operator control. The system is equipped with image processing-based fire control infrastructure and wide-angle electro-optical systems, enabling operations in both day and night conditions. One of its standout capabilities compared to systems in its class is the ability to track moving targets, execute precise point strikes, and perform flexible mission modes such as flight termination, strike waiver-off, or self-destruction. Additionally, an electronic proximity fuse determines the optimal detonation time before impact, enhancing destructive effect.
ALPAGU is particularly suited for counter-terrorism, border security, urban combat, and asymmetric warfare scenarios. Moreover, by enabling cost-effective and efficient destruction of high-risk targets, it serves as an alternative to conventional munitions. Additionally, when combined with a multi-launcher option integrable with ground vehicles, it can generate area effects in intense combat zones.
As of 2023, ALPAGU was exported abroad for the first time. Although it has not yet been officially integrated into the inventory of the Turkish Armed Forces, procurement processes are underway and field tests have been completed. Like STM’s other systems, KARGU and TOGAN, ALPAGU has attracted significant international interest from various continents and countries, expanding its export portfolio.
The term “Alpagu” in Old Turkish means “a brave warrior who attacks the enemy alone.” The UAV’s lightweight structure, high maneuverability, and precision strike capability directly align with this meaning.
